Letter of Credit (Documentary Credit)

--- Opens by means of airmail
The sample letter of credit (L/C) below is a comprehensive case study of a Confirmed Irrevocable Letter of Credit opens by means of airmail.

Dear Sirs:
We have been requested by     The Sun Bank, Sunlight City, Import-Country
to advise that they have opened with us their     irrevocable           documentary credit number     SB-87654
for account of     DEF Imports, 7 Sunshine Street, Sunlight City, Import-Country
in your favor for the amount of     not exceeding Twenty Five Thousand U.S. Dollars (US$25,000.00)


 
available by your draft(s) drawn on     us
                                                      at     sight                                           for     full             invoice value

 
accompanied by the following documents:

 
1.   Signed commercial invoice in five (5) copies indicating the buyer's
Purchase Order No. DEF-101 dated January 10, 2001.

 
2.   Packing list in five (5) copies.

 
3.   Full set 3/3 clean on board ocean bill of lading, plus two (2) non-negotiable copies, issued to order of The Sun Bank, Sunlight City, Import-Country, notify the above accountee, marked "freight Prepaid", dated latest March 19, 2001, and showing documentary credit number.

 
4.   Insurance policy in duplicate for 110% CIF value covering Institute Cargo Clauses (A), Institute War and Strike Clauses, evidencing that claims are payable in Import-Country.



 
Covering:     100 Sets 'ABC' Brand Pneumatic Tools, 1/2" drive,
                complete with hose and quick couplings, CIF Sunny Port
Shipment from Moonbeam Port, Export-Country       to     Sunny Port, Import-Country
Partial shipment prohibited
Transhipment permitted

Special conditions:

 
1.   All documents indicating the Import License No. IP/123456 dated January 18, 2001.
2.   All charges outside the Import-Country are on beneficiary's account.
Documents must be presented for payment within     15               days after the date of shipment.
Draft(s) drawn under this credit must be marked

      Drawn under documentary credit No. SB-87654 of The Sun Bank,
      Sunlight City, Import-Country, dated January 26, 2001


 
We confirm this credit and hereby undertake that all drafts drawn under and in conformity with the
terms of this credit will be duly honored upon delivery of documents as specified, if presented at
this office on or before    
March 26, 2001


 
  Very truly yours,

 
 
  Authorized Signature


Unless otherwise expressly stated, this Credit is subject to the Uniform Customs and Practice for Documentary Credits, 1993 Revision, International Chamber of Commerce Publication No. 500.
